The Las Vegas Walk of Stars was established by the Motion Picture Hall of Fame Foundation, which is "an institution dedicated to the preservation and memory of the best of the best in the motion-picture industry" and occupies a four-mile stretch of sidewalk on both sides of the Strip, from Sahara Avenue to Russell Road. It honors "people of prominence in entertainment, sports, literature, the military, and humanitarian and civic fields."
Each actual star consists of a three-foot-square slab of polished granite weighing up to 350 pounds and inlaid with the recipient's name and specialty. The WOS' first inductee was Wayne Newton, honored in October 2004; his star is outside the New Frontier, where Newton performed for 15 years.
Back in 2006, when we previously answered this, the latest people of prominence to be inducted were the Society of Seven (on Nov. 28 of that year), who'd been performing in one incarnation or another for more than 30 years. Their star is in front of the Flamingo but in April, 2008 the group played its last gig in that showroom. One member of the cast, however - singer Lani Misalucha - is currently performing in the show Voices at the Las Vegas Hilton (so plurally named because originally she performed alongside Earl Turner, who left unexpectedly), while the remainder of Society of Seven, plus a new female vocalist, are enjoying an extended run at Gold Coast through March 28.
More recent inductees now include Elvis (Sept. 2008, located outside the Riviera), show producer Dick Feeney (Oct. 2008, New York-New York), Bobby Darin (May 2007, Flamingo), and Sammy Davis Jr. (Feb. 2007, Riviera).
Other inductees include Siegfried and Roy, Liberace, Rich Little, and Wayne Allyn Root (author of The Zen of Gambling and one of the most recognized professional sports prognosticators in the world).
